Hermès' Un Jardin sur la Lagune eau de toilette, crafted in 2019 by the esteemed perfumer Christine Nagel, isn't merely a fragrance; it's an olfactory journey. It's an invitation to explore a hidden Venetian garden, a secret sanctuary where the whispers of salt-laced air mingle with the intoxicating blooms of a landscape untouched by time. This evocative scent transcends the typical boundaries of gender, appealing to both men and women who appreciate a sophisticated, nuanced fragrance with a distinct personality. The fragrance's enduring appeal lies in its ability to capture the essence of a specific place and time, translating the unique sensory experience of a Venetian lagoon into a wearable art form.
Un Jardin sur la Lagune Eau de Toilette: A Sensory Escape to Venice
The Un Jardin sur la Lagune eau de toilette belongs to Hermès' celebrated "Un Jardin" collection, a series renowned for its evocative and naturalistic compositions. Unlike many modern perfumes that prioritize bold, immediately striking notes, Un Jardin sur la Lagune unfolds gradually, revealing its complexity with each wear. It's a fragrance that demands patience, rewarding the wearer with a constantly evolving sensory experience.
The initial spritz introduces a refreshing burst of vibrant green notes. These aren't the sharp, grassy greens often found in other fragrances; instead, they possess a softer, almost watery quality, perfectly mirroring the lagoon's gentle currents. This opening is immediately followed by the subtle sweetness of delicate flowers, a delicate bouquet that avoids being overly saccharine. The floral heart is carefully balanced, preventing any single note from dominating. Instead, it creates a harmonious blend of natural scents, reminiscent of a wildflower meadow blooming near the water's edge.
As the fragrance settles onto the skin, the salty tang of the sea air becomes increasingly prominent. This isn't a harsh, overpowering salinity; it's a soft, almost ethereal whisper, evoking the feeling of a gentle sea breeze carrying the scent of the lagoon. This salty note is masterfully integrated with the other elements, creating a unique and unforgettable olfactory signature. The base notes provide a grounding warmth, a subtle woody aroma that anchors the fragrance without overpowering its delicate top and heart notes. This skillful layering of notes allows the scent to transition seamlessly throughout the day, revealing different facets depending on the wearer's body chemistry and the surrounding environment.
